技术文摘
vue里meta的使用方法
vue里meta的使用方法
在Vue开发中,meta的合理运用能够极大地提升应用的用户体验和搜索引擎优化效果。
我们来看看在Vue组件中如何使用meta。在每个Vue组件的选项对象里,都可以定义meta字段。通过这个字段,我们可以为组件添加一些自定义的元数据。比如,我们有一个需要特定权限才能访问的组件,就可以在meta里设置权限信息。示例代码如下:
export default {
name: 'MyComponent',
meta: {
requiresAuth: true
},
// 组件的其他选项
}
在路由守卫中,我们就可以利用这个meta信息进行权限验证。这样,当用户尝试访问该组件对应的路由时,就能根据meta里的权限信息判断是否有权限进入。
Vue Router中的meta使用也十分关键。我们在定义路由配置时,可以在每个路由对象里设置meta字段。例如:
const routes = [
{
path: '/home',
name: 'Home',
component: Home,
meta: {
title: '首页',
keywords: 'Vue,首页,内容',
description: '这是Vue应用的首页'
}
},
// 其他路由配置
]
这里设置的meta信息可以用来优化网页的SEO。当页面加载时,我们可以通过一些方法将meta里的title、keywords和description等信息设置到HTML的头部,让搜索引擎更好地识别页面内容。比如,利用一个全局守卫来设置页面标题:
router.beforeEach((to, from, next) => {
document.title = to.meta.title || '默认标题';
next();
})
meta还能用于控制页面的布局和样式等。我们可以在meta里定义一些布局相关的信息,然后在组件的mounted钩子函数里根据这些信息进行相应的DOM操作或样式设置。
Vue里meta的使用场景丰富多样。无论是权限管理、SEO优化,还是页面布局与样式控制,合理利用meta都能让我们的Vue应用更加健壮、易用且符合搜索引擎友好的标准。开发者需要深入理解并灵活运用meta,为用户打造出优质的应用体验。
TAGS: vue meta使用 meta基本概念 meta应用场景 meta配置细节
- 如何安装与卸载 Java 在 Ubuntu 24.04 LTS 中
- Windows 系统利用 route 命令添加自定义永久路由的办法
- Windows 系统中 DLL 文件的详细解读
- Win10 添加硬件的方法介绍
- Win11 24H2 更新现新 Bug 致使 8.63GB 缓存无法清理
- 微软 Win11 24H2 SMB 传输慢 千兆网络变百兆 用户反馈问题
- Win10 Beta / RP 19045.4713 补丁 KB5040525 及更新内容
- Win10 中打印机打印浓度的调整及清晰度设置方法
- Win10 内部版本 19044.4651 与 19045.4651 迎来更新补丁 KB5040427(附更新汇总)
- 如何使用 Mac filevault 文件保险箱加密 macOS 数据
- Mac 电脑查看 CPU 使用率的方法及技巧
- 哪些 Mac 能够升级 macOS 15 Sequoia?支持机型汇总列表
- 苹果 macOS 15 设置界面重大更新:优化选项布局 重新设计图标
- 如何在 VMware 虚拟机中复制/克隆/导出 VMDK 文件
- 华为纯血鸿蒙 HarmonyOS NEXT 公测开启 申请方法在此